    Purpose
    Rabbit polyclonal to Phospho-MARK1/2/3/4 (T215).
    Specificity
    Phospho-MARK1/2/3/4 (T215) Polyclonal Antibody detects endogenous levels of MARK1/2/3/4 protein only when phosphorylated at T215.
    Purification
    The antibody was affinity-purified from rabbit antiserum by affinity-chromatography using epitope-specific immunogen.
    Immunogen
    Synthesized peptide derived from human MARK1/2/3/4 around the phosphorylation site of T215.
